2. What Are Cookies?

Cookies are small text files that are placed on your device (computer, tablet, or mobile phone) when you visit a website. Cookies are widely used to make websites work more efficiently and to provide information to website owners.

Cookies allow a website to recognize your device and store some information about your preferences or past actions. This helps us provide you with a better experience when you browse our website and allows us to improve our site.

5. How Long Do Cookies Last?

Cookies can be either "session" cookies or "persistent" cookies:

  • Session Cookies: These are temporary cookies that expire when you close your browser. They allow the website to link your actions during a browsing session.
  • Persistent Cookies: These remain on your device for a set period or until you delete them. They are activated each time you visit the website that created them.

The specific retention period for each cookie varies. Essential cookies typically last for the duration of your session, while functional and analytics cookies may persist for longer periods (typically 30 days to 2 years, depending on the cookie).

7. Other Tracking Technologies

In addition to cookies, we may use other similar tracking technologies:

  • Web Beacons/Pixel Tags: Small graphic images that may be included in our emails or web pages to track whether messages have been opened
  • Local Storage: Technology that allows websites to store information locally on your device (similar to cookies but with more storage capacity)
  • Session Storage: Temporary storage that is cleared when you close your browser

These technologies are used for similar purposes to cookies and can be managed through your browser settings.
